How popular is Rhyder?
2013peak year
Today, Rhyder is rarely chosen — ranked well outside the top 1,000 (around #2339), with only about 72 babies given the name per year. But it wasn't always this way. At its peak in 2013, 98 babies were given the name (ranked #1585 nationally). Its strongest stretch was the 2010s. Rhyder's usage has held roughly steady recently. In all, around 1,333 babies have been registered as Rhyder since 1880.
